WhereToStay.com triples reviews

Since the launch of the company’s “Reward the Reviewer” program earlier this year, WhereToStay.com has tripled its monthly reviews from travelers offering a first-hand account of a recently-visited hotel property.As part of the promotion, which was created to help celebrate the website’s 10-year anniversary, travelers who write a review of a hotel property on WhereToStay.com will have the chance to win an iPod nano MP3 Player.  One prize will be awarded each quarter of 2006.

“We are extremely pleased with the excitement that this promotion has generated among consumers,” said Thom Dunaway, founder and president of WhereToStay.com.  “Our mission is to provide unbiased reviews of properties around the world, and we are happy to be able to offer an exciting incentive for travelers to post their opinions on our site,” he added.

In an effort to list and feature traveler reviews for every accommodation on the planet, WhereToStay.com has introduced new marketing and promotion initiatives, such as the “Reward the Reviewer” program and its recently-launched, six-month-long “Getaway Giveaway” consumer promotion (awarding a vacation prize valued at over $4,500) to heighten awareness and demonstrate the value of using WhereToStay.com as the primary research tool when looking for vacation accommodation options.

As the first travel website to feature traveler reviews, WhereToStay.com redefined the industry, giving travelers a voice and providing hotels with impartial feedback.  The traveler review star-rating system points readers in the right direction, with unbiased and verifiable travel accounts.  Reviews are closely monitored and tracked by an editing staff to ensure legitimacy and accountability.
